History of Gambling

Early forms of gambling can be traced back to ancient civilizations like the Greeks and Romans. These societies had various games of chance that were popular among the people, showcasing the timeless allure of risking something valuable for the chance of a greater reward.

As time progressed, gambling evolved and found its place in different cultures around the world. From the Chinese playing games of chance with tiles to the Europeans betting on horse races and card games, gambling became a universal pastime that transcended borders and social classes.

In modern times, the gambling industry has grown exponentially, with the rise of casinos, online betting platforms, and lotteries offering diverse options for individuals to try their luck. Despite facing criticisms and regulations, gambling continues to be a significant aspect of many societies worldwide.

Types of Gambling

When it comes to different types of gambling, casinos are among the most popular choices. With a wide array of games such as slots, blackjack, roulette, and poker, casinos provide a thrilling experience for those seeking their luck.

Sports betting is another prevalent form of gambling where individuals wager on the outcome of sporting events. Whether it’s football, basketball, or horse racing, sports betting allows fans to get more involved and potentially win money based on their predictions.

Lotteries are a widely accessible form of gambling that offers participants the chance to win big prizes with just a small investment. From national lotteries to scratch-off tickets, lotteries cater to a broad audience looking for a quick and easy way to try their luck.

Impact of Gambling

The impact of gambling can be far-reaching, affecting individuals, families, and communities. Many people see gambling as a form of entertainment, but for some, it can spiral into a destructive habit that leads to financial ruin and strained relationships.

One of the key implications of gambling is the financial strain it can place on individuals and families. For problem gamblers, the urge to continue risking money can lead to significant debts, bankruptcy, and even loss of assets such as homes and vehicles.

Beyond the financial consequences, the emotional toll of gambling addiction is often overlooked. Feelings of guilt, shame, and anxiety can consume individuals who are caught in the cycle of gambling, impacting their mental health and well-being. Family members and loved ones also experience stress and trauma as they witness the destructive effects of gambling on their relationships and daily lives.
